PSA-5454+ Frequently Asked Questions (FAQs)

  • Mini-Circuits recommends a 4-layer PCB with a solid ground plane on the bottom layer, and a microstrip layout with 50-ohm impedance. Proper grounding and decoupling are crucial for optimal performance and noise reduction.
  • To achieve the best possible noise figure and gain flatness, ensure that the amplifier is operated within its recommended operating conditions, use a high-quality DC power supply, and optimize the input and output matching networks. Additionally, consider using a low-noise voltage regulator and decoupling capacitors to minimize noise and ripple.
  • The PSA-5454+ can handle input powers up to +10 dBm without damage. However, it's recommended to operate the amplifier with input powers below +5 dBm to ensure optimal performance and prevent compression.
  • Yes, the PSA-5454+ can be used in a non-50-ohm system, but it requires impedance matching to achieve optimal performance. Mini-Circuits provides a set of impedance matching charts and equations in the application notes to help designers match the amplifier to their specific system impedance.
  • The PSA-5454+ operates over a temperature range of -40°C to +85°C. Temperature affects the amplifier's performance, with increased noise figure and decreased gain at higher temperatures. It's essential to consider temperature compensation and thermal management in the system design to ensure optimal performance.

About Mini-Circuits

Mini-Circuits is a global leader in the design, manufacturing, and distribution of RF and microwave components and systems. The company's product portfolio includes a vast array of components such as amplifiers, mixers, splitters, couplers, filters, switches, and attenuators, among others. These components cover frequency ranges from DC to 65 GHz and beyond, serving applications in wireless communication, satellite communication, radar systems, test and measurement equipment, medical devices, and more.
